Grasping Cross Device Advancement

Cross-platform progression represents a fundamental shift in how gaming accounts operate on different platforms and systems. This technology allows gamers to maintain consistent progress regardless of whether they play on personal computers, gaming consoles, mobile devices, or cloud-based services. By synchronizing achievements, character development, and in-game purchases throughout these interconnected platforms, progression systems reduce the frustration of repetitive grinding and allow players to resume from their last point seamlessly. This linked system has become increasingly vital as gamers demand continuity in their gaming experiences.

The technical backbone behind multi-device progression leverages sophisticated cloud-based systems that safely maintain and synchronize player data instantly. When a gamer finishes a mission on their PlayStation, that achievement shows up right away when they switch to their PC or smartphone. This syncing goes further than simple progress tracking to include character customization, inventory management, and ranked standings. Such seamless integration dramatically changes player expectations, making account portability a essential capability rather than a optional addition in contemporary gaming.

Benefits of Seamless Account Handling

Multi-device progression systems offer remarkable accessibility to today's players by removing the frustration of duplicate efforts across devices. Players can effortlessly transition between their PC, console, and mobile devices while keeping their character development, cosmetic purchases, and accomplishment logs. This ongoing connection revolutionizes how players engage into a truly flexible experience, enabling gamers to enjoy their preferred games on their own schedule, without losing investment or earned progress.

Beyond ease of use, unified profile handling fosters deeper player engagement and loyalty. When gamers know their progress persists across platforms, they're more likely to commit effort and money into games, creating deeper attachments to their accounts. This unified approach also reduces frustration from device-based restrictions, encourages longer play sessions across multiple devices, and ultimately enhances player satisfaction by respecting their time investment and offering true adaptability in how they experience their favorite games.
